In Naples, explore one of the world's most renowned archaeology museums during this small group tour. With an expert guide by your side, uncovering and interpreting the vast collection at the National Archaeological Museum becomes a fascinating journey.

Guided Tour Highlights

  • The art and culture of ancient civilizations come alive as you explore Greek and Roman sculptures, frescoes, mosaics, and artifacts.
  • Your archaeologist guide will share insights into the treasures found at Herculaneum and Pompeii; explore the Farnese Collection; and discover the Gabinetto Segreto.

Upon entering the museum, you'll be captivated by the grandeur of marble statues in the Farnese collection. Explore galleries showcasing legendary sculptures like Hercules and the majestic ‘Farnese Bull.’ Walk through rooms adorned with mosaics depicting Alexander the Great, along with Roman frescoes from Pompeii's House of Menandro.
